Developing Proper Technique and Form Iaito are typically made from aluminum or zinc alloys, which provide a lightweight feel while still mimicking the balance of a traditional katana. The construction of an iaito often includes a well-designed tsuba and tsuka that ensure a comfortable grip. Safety and Training Considerations While wooden katanas are significantly safer than their metal counterparts, there are still important safety considerations to keep in mind during training. Proper protective gear, such as gloves and masks, should be worn to minimize the risk of injury during sparring sessions. Additionally, instructors must emphasize the importance of control and awareness during practice to ensure that students are mindful of their surroundings and the positions of their training partners.
